To create a channel, right swipe on the homepage, and tap on “New Channel”. Provide your channel name, description, select channel type, and create a unique URL. That’s it. Just press and hold on the message you want to change and then tap the “edit” button. From there, you can modify the message and resend it. Telegram will put an “edited” label on the message to let recipients know of the update. To do this, head over to Telegram’s settings by sliding over the hamburger menu from the left of the app. Here, choose ‘Settings’ and then click on ‘Chat Settings’. In this menu, you will see a number of themes and colour options to choose from. Further, you can also change the curve on message boxes and font size. Telegram is a multi-platform messaging service founded by Russian entrepreneur Pavel Durov, although it was temporarily banned in Russia and has no affiliation with any government or company. It first rolled out on iOS and Android in late 2013, and now has an estimated 550 million monthly users. Telegram’s user base tends to increase whenever a privacy scandal hits one of its larger competitors.
